Luke 17:14-25 Catholic Public Domain Version (CPDV)

14. And when he saw them, he said, "Go, show yourselves to the priests." And it happened that, as they were going, they were cleansed.

15. And one of them, when he saw that he was cleansed, returned, magnifying God with a loud voice.

16. And he fell face down before his feet, giving thanks. And this one was a Samaritan.

17. And in response, Jesus said: "Were not ten made clean? And so where are the nine?

18. Was no one found who would return and give glory to God, except this foreigner?"

19. And he said to him: "Rise up, go forth. For your faith has saved you."

20. Then he was questioned by the Pharisees: "When does the kingdom of God arrive?" And in response, he said to them: "The kingdom of God arrives unobserved.

21. And so, they will not say, 'Behold, it is here,' or 'Behold, it is there.' For behold, the kingdom of God is within you."

22. And he said to his disciples: "The time will come when you will desire to see one day of the Son of man, and you will not see it.

23. And they will say to you, 'Behold, he is here,' and 'Behold, he is there.' Do not choose to go out, and do not follow them.

24. For just as lightning flashes from under heaven and shines to whatever is under heaven, so also will the Son of man be in his day.

25. But first he must suffer many things and be rejected by this generation.
